On Mon, Mar 16, 2020 at 11:47:00AM +0100, Alexandre Belloni wrote: > Move SIMPLE_DEV_PM_OPS out of #ifdef to fix build issues when PM_SLEEP is > not selected. > > Signed-off-by: Alexandre Belloni <alexandre.belloni@xxxxxxxxxxx> > --- > drivers/rtc/rtc-mt2712.c | 2 +- > 1 file changed, 1 insertion(+), 1 deletion(-) > > diff --git a/drivers/rtc/rtc-mt2712.c b/drivers/rtc/rtc-mt2712.c > index 432df9b0a3ac..c2709c1602f0 100644 > --- a/drivers/rtc/rtc-mt2712.c > +++ b/drivers/rtc/rtc-mt2712.c > @@ -394,10 +394,10 @@ static int mt2712_rtc_resume(struct device *dev) > > return 0; > } > +#endif Maybe use __maybe_unused for these, so they can still be compile-tested rather than #if'd out? -- RMK's Patch system: https://www.armlinux.org.uk/developer/patches/ FTTC broadband for 0.8mile line in suburbia: sync at 10.2Mbps down 587kbps up